Type
ORACLE
Validation date
2024-04-02 08:33: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03384,
    "usd": 0.03635
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018A0FF965D8E5ABC62AB69C834F1BAC546C875F77069DD75B81A2A272E5ED83A0

Previous signature

902C6041B16C3B6125D41CC73E243E4E4981306400F7D66B4B78A00CCC13EB0447EF3414B715BE7CDDD5F1DCB215EA3882BCBDFEFB722805ABB368B35720E804

Origin signature

304502202507A1CE41BE65E770E4AD5B75D364B89CAC532A88DDF74DDF97358A7242BD25022100A7445D08FEE9A955B2529BC16FEED18ABB0CCA03BE93852223F622AAF2FADB7C

Proof of work

01010484B78F4110D8E9D6FBEC72759895CC9D4532177314FBAA8B07BC525FC1AF48F150EFBF104B1819106B8E3563CD0E1FAAE5325F8FCFE58FF744C35F47669D2704

Proof of integrity

002375C36F83842F654F23AF2E6AEDC8981FF0353E6E1AA7521816FC21BCB52482

Coordinator signature

D734766A88A7250B4AB797C9AE1F722F8C345D3AD8AD36ECEA21C297264C0737871FBA7641C41DA93CF52CA69A30E00EABDBB2D1B7B276F0193E571CA6F8C502

Validator #1 public key

00011ED0B570D680BE5ECD58D2D121689DA73C46DCB38A01C6E10D06286040ADE30A

Validator #1 signature

3CF22AD0B709F920FD2FEF0513C94FA4CE6A1D9A48006782DA7691A61E8DDEB5118D016754D5B2AF00765FD028BD503C6889D0CB071A1908FDC615F932B3DB07

Validator #2 public key

0001B01EEF96BA7E95FC844D456CE8868F18864519FC9532E1751C2035FD044DD5D0

Validator #2 signature

986BBC6180A8E0C5832C5DB8650CB1F22B89E8E2F0E5B55CEF56DD6518B35DD96F73C985C477FDACA4632477553AA2ECFA6CB53C8ADC4379575B89B48FAEA204